EVERY year Information Victoria presents a unique Rural Christmas Market to support small rural businesses and country cottage industries.
The wide range of hand-crafted products come from across the state.
A variety of regional food can be found at this market – jams, preserves, fudges, olive products, Christmas puddings and food hampers.
The market also features wood crafts and metalwork, sheepskin and woollen products, hand-made glass work, emu oil products, a large range of lavender products, hemp products, pottery, natural skin care, Aboriginal artwork and soft toys.
